A Facile and Efficient One‐Pot Protocol for Synthesis of 3‐Selenocyanated Imidazo[1,2‐a]Pyridines

Lei Wang, Yikai Zhang, Chaoyu Wang, Like Jiang, Huiru Pan, Shuyu Lai, Xinyu Cao, Yanjie Wang, Guoqun Liu, Huijie Qiao, Liting Yang

ABSTRACT

A mild, transition‐metal‐free one‐pot tandem procedure was developed for the regioselective C3‐selenocyanation of imidazo[1,2‐a]pyridines by employing readily available 2‐aminopyridines, α‐bromo ketones, and potassium selenocyanate (KSeCN) as starting materials. This sequential transformation integrates the in situ construction of the imidazo[1,2‐a]pyridine skeleton and subsequent oxidative C3‐selenocyanation into a single operation, avoiding tedious isolation and purification of intermediates. Substrate investigations demonstrate that a broad spectrum of functionalized derivatives can be obtained with isolated yields ranging from 61% to 93%, which fully reveals the excellent functional group tolerance and high synthetic efficiency of this newly developed method. The synthetic route offers straightforward operation and reduced synthetic steps with lower waste generation, serving as a convenient synthetic access to selenocyanate‐functionalized imidazo[1,2‐a]pyridine scaffolds for subsequent biological and material investigations.
